Life Left C'ville on my motorcycle 3 weeks after graduation in 6/78 to return to S. Florida's tropical climes. By August I had a real job, my own apartment and real bills. Met my future and present wife, Cathy, in 10/78 in my own apartment. Ask me that one sometime! We stayed together about one year after which I decided she just wasn't cool enough any more and didn't fit with the new me (see below). For those who remember, ahhhh, I wasn't exactly college material at the time so I worked various and sundry jobs for a year or so, including a/c ductwork (one of Dante's circles of hell in summer) and warehouseman at a dairy plant. Then, in 10/79 at the wisened age of 18, I found my calling...as a bartender. First gig was the Fontainebleau on Miami Beach and my last the Miami Playboy Club in '85 which is not nearly as glamorous as it may sound. Hit a lot of branches on the way down that tree in six years. Managed to get a few years of local college under my belt along the way. Because I was fit and (ahem) some said handsome, I made it onto Miami Vice in '84, Season 1, Episode 3, "Cool Runnin'". I'm the stiff cop guarding a Jamaican prisoner while Crokett and Tubbs question him. I then do my roboto-man imitation as I escort him out. Philip Michael Thomas was nice, Don Johnson a jerk. That was my less than 15 minutes of fame, I made about $45, the chow on on the set was great, I got to bs with Philip Michael Thomas and then I never did anything else. In mid-'85 I'd had enough of the high life and got cleaned up while working in a marina. Got back together with Cathy. Had always worked out and stayed fit but really got into it then, spending 4-6 hours a day in the gym and going from my HS weight of 145 to 215lbs with a 33" waist in 6 months. I was big. Cathy and I married in 3/87 while I was joining the Life and Health insurance business at the behest of my father for lack of any better ideas.
